QUARTERLY PLANNING NOTE — Branch Managers

This note outlines the revised sales-commission scheme for Vantry Goods branches, effective next quarter. The flat 4% rate is replaced by a tiered structure rewarding retention and multi-line sales, designed after careful review of last year's distortions in the Ashgrove branch. Please brief your teams only on the mechanics, not the underlying strategy. Delia Harrowgate will host a walkthrough session. The confidential strategic note follows immediately below.

internal memo for hafog-hadug: The pricing group signed off on a budget of $16.1 million for Project Gorir. The renewal with Oliionax Systems closes at $14.1 million a year, 46 percent above the last contract.

Handover: Skimcache tile prefetcher. Prediction model retrained Monday; hit rate up to 81%. Known issue: prefetch storms at zoom-level transitions — throttle patch in review. Cron warms coastal regions at 03:00. Don't bump the concurrency cap without checking memory headroom on the edge nodes. Ongoing ownership and review duties transfer to the engineer named below.

named custodian: Brivan Eliath Quenox Frador

Action item from the Ferrowpay flaky-test saga: the integration suite was racing the ledger container's startup, so roughly one run in twenty hit a connection refused and we all got used to hitting retry. Bad habit. Tomas is adding a proper readiness probe plus bounded retries to the test harness, so future maintainers shouldn't need to babysit CI. If you do need to tweak things, the retry and timeout constants live here:

tuning table, faweg-bajep:
WEIGHTS = {
    "belius": 690,
    "eliox": 458,
    "norax": 616,
    "praion": 132,
    "zorvan": 911,
}